Salts of A, B and C were electrolysed under identical conditions using the same quantity of electricity. It was found that when 2.1 ~g of A was deposited, the weights of B and C deposited were 2.7 ~g and 9.6 ~g . If the atomic mass of A, B and C respectively are 7,27 and 64 respectively, then the valancies of A, B and C respectively are

Options

  1. A3,1,2
  2. B1,3,2
  3. C3,1,3
  4. D2,3,2

Correct answer

B. 1,3,2

Step-by-step solution

Using concept of Faraday law, Now, A^ n₁⁺ +n₁ e⁻ A Similarly, B^ n₂⁺ +n₂ e⁻ B and, C ^ n₃⁺ +n₃ e⁻ C Since, charge is same then equivalent weight is same, array ll & 2.1 7 n₁ = 2.7 27 n₂ = 7.2 48 n₃ & 3 n₁ 10 = 1 n₂ 10 = 3 n₃ 2 10 n₁= n₂ 3 = n₃ 2 & n₁=1, n₂=3 and n₃=2 array Hence, valencies of A, B and C are 1,3 and 2 .
